Documentos de Académico
Documentos de Profesional
Documentos de Cultura
DataLoggerNIOS II
DataLoggerNIOS II
Resumen
Para la realización del proyecto se aplican cuatro etapas. La primera etapa está basada en obtener
los datos mediante el uso de sensores y la transmisión usando un PIC, la siguiente etapa se basa
principalmente en la recepción de los datos, la tercera etapa consiste en utilizar la pantalla LCD de la
tarjeta DE2 para mostrar los datos obtenidos y una última etapa donde se procede a almacenar los
datos en una tarjeta SD Card.
Abstract
This project involves the implementation of a Datalogger using the NIOS II microprocessor which is
embedded in a CYCLONE II FPGA, which is integrated into the ALTERA DE2 development board, in
addition to obtaining data from different sensors and store them on an SD Card.
For the project apply four stages. The first stage is based on data obtained by using transmission
sensors and using a PIC, the next stage is mainly based on the reception of data, the third stage is to use
the card LCD screen for displaying DE2 data and a final stage where we store the data on a SD card.
La tarjeta de desarrollo DE2 de Altera nos brinda Para ir a la par con esta evolución tecnológica se
algunas alternativas para poder cumplir con los presenta el desarrollo de un sistema que permita
almacenar en tiempo real valores de parámetros • Hasta 1.1Mbits de memoria RAM útil,
que sean de interés, para luego analizar dichos sin reducir la lógica disponible.
valores y verificar la funcionalidad del sistema • 4,096 bits de memoria por bloque
implementado.
Conversión
3.3.5 Módulo XBEE ADC
Transmisión
[3]. Los módulos Xbee trabajan mediante el Serial
NO
protocolo Zigbee. Zigbee es un protocolo de
comunicaciones inalámbrico basado en el estándar Recepción
Serial
de comunicación para redes inalámbricas IEEE
802.15.4. Zigbee permite que dispositivos Visualizar datos en
LCD
electrónicos de bajo consumo puedan realizar sus
comunicaciones inalámbricas. Las comunicaciones
Zigbee se realizan en la banda libre de 2.4GHz.
Las características del módulo Xbee se muestran a SD Ingresada SI
Almacenar datos en
SD Card
continuación:
5. Resultados
En esta sección se muestra el resultado de la
implementación del datalogger. Los datos
transmitidos son recibidos en la tarjeta DE2 y
Figura 5. Esquemático Transmisor mostrados en la pantalla LCD.
• En base los objetivos planteados se pudo [1]. Tarjeta de desarrollo de2 de altera,
generar un sistema para una tarjeta de https://paruro.pe/productos/tarjeta-altera-de2
desarrollo NIOS II, y a su vez compilar [2]. Revisión de l a FPGA CYCLONE II
un software en lenguaje C que permita http://www.altera.com/devices/fpga/cyclone2
cumplir con los requisitos básicos de un /overview/cy2-overview.html
Datalogger. [3]. Guia del Usuario Xbee Series 1 Andres
• El uso del lenguaje C como herramienta Oyarse Pag 6
para desarrollar una serie de instrucciones [4]. SOPC Builder guía del usuario
que sirven para controlar el http://www.altera.com/literature/ug/ug_sopc_
funcionamiento del proyecto, demuestra builder.pdf
la versatilidad que posee este lenguaje de [5]. Estructura del microprocesador NIOS II,
alto nivel para obtener una Altera Corporation Nios II Processor
implementación en hardware acorde a los Reference Handbook- Pág. 18
requerimientos establecidos del proyecto. [6]. Sistema basado en el microprocesador NIOS
• Se implementó un hardware básico II, Estudio del Microprocesador NIOS II
usando la tarjeta DE 2 de Altera que Jorge Rodríguez Araújo 14
puede ser usado como guía para realizar [7]. Elementos del Xbee, Andrés Oyarce Xbee
futuras mejoras como; enviar los datos a Series 1 Guía del Usuario - Pág. 10
través de la red, controlar el sistema de
manera remota, entre otras
funcionalidades, por lo tanto; se puede
concluir que se consiguió un sistema
versátil y eficiente con posibilidades de
ampliar su capacidad y funcionalidad en
diseños futuros.
7. Recomendaciones